OPERATING YOUR NEW ZTR MOWER (cont.)

MOWING

WARNING: Do not operate mower at too fast of a rate. Sudden movements forward and backward at fast speeds can cause accidents resulting in personal injury

Start out slowly moving steering levers SLOWLY forward and backward until you learn to operate the unit. NOTE: This mower has been designed to be very maneuverable. Practice is extremely necessary in open, flat areas to become comfortable and efficient with the controls.

BEGIN TO MOW: Before starting the engine, set the desired deck height.

Start the mower engine.

Position the throttle lever about halfway and engage PTO switch. Reposition throttle lever to full throttle position.

Move steering levers forward to begin mowing.

CAUTION: Always make sure the deck is not plugged with grass or other debris. Failure to do this will cause damage to the PTO belt.

STOPPING: Hydrostatic mowers use hydrostatic braking through the transmissions. To slow or stop the unit move the steering levers to the neutral position

STOPPING THE ENGINE: Move the throttle lever to slow position, allow engine

to idle for 30 seconds and turn ignition to off position. CAUTION: Failure to position the ignition key to any position except off will cause discharge of the battery.

ZT17542 specifications

The Swisher ZT17542 is a robust and versatile zero-turn mower designed to transform the lawn care experience. Known for its high performance and durability, this mower is ideal for homeowners with vast lawns or landscaping professionals seeking efficiency and reliability.

At the heart of the Swisher ZT17542 is its powerful 17.5 HP Briggs & Stratton engine. This engine provides plenty of torque and power to tackle even the toughest mowing tasks. With its overhead valve design and efficient fuel consumption, the engine not only enhances performance but also minimizes emissions, making it an eco-friendly option for users.

The ZT17542 features a 42-inch cutting deck, which is a perfect size for maneuvering through tight spaces and around obstacles while still enabling a wide cutting swath. The deck is made of heavy-duty steel, providing increased durability and resistance to wear and tear. With a cutting height range that can be easily adjusted from 1.5 to 4.5 inches, users can customize their mowing experience according to the specific needs of their lawn.

One of the standout features of the Swisher ZT17542 is its dual-hydrostatic transmission. This technology allows for seamless control of speed and direction, equivalent to a professional-grade mower. Operators can enjoy a superior turning radius and precise navigation, making it easy to trim around flower beds, trees, and fences.

Additionally, the ZT17542 comes equipped with an ergonomic seat and controls, allowing for extended periods of comfortable mowing. The high-back seat offers lumbar support, while the controls are intuitively placed for easy access, minimizing fatigue during long jobs.

Another notable characteristic of this mower is its maintenance-friendly design. With both a deck wash port and easy-to-remove components, upkeep and cleaning are straightforward, ensuring that the mower remains in peak condition for years to come.

In terms of safety, the Swisher ZT17542 includes features like a foot-operated deck lift and a safety key, ensuring that operators can work confidently.
